Gürses (Kurmanji: Davudi) is a neighbourhood in the municipality and district of Çınar, Diyarbakır Province in Turkey.[1] Its population is 55 (2022).[2] The village is inhabited by Yazidis. The village is located ca. 9 kilometres (5.6 mi) southwest of Çınar in southeastern Anatolia.[3]
